I came into this unfocused mess of awesome ideas 4 years after release, because i tried the demo at PAX2013 and felt like a ME3 console shooter, horrible GUI and all. I can't even recognize that game in the current build, which is a co-op TPS / hack n slash with so many different currencies and features they probably make most of their profits with initial purchases. People wanting to just buy everything with plat at the beginning than learn about endo, credits, void relics, affinity seem to be a lot of the people with purchase-only equipment.

Missions are repetitive and rough around the edges, similar to its Bungie competitor Destiny, with none of that game's price gouging or locked content. Enemy variety, from three main factions of enemies, Infested, Grineer and Corpus provide the bare minimum from making them outright boring.

Quests have surprisingly strong narrative which feels disconnected from most of the gameplay in said quests, with special boss fights being the exception. This game knows at what point to introduce you to a new system, let it be Focus, the companions, the operators, archwings, etc.

Syndicates play out a lot like factions in Fallout, as they provide unique quests and rewards and aesthetically go overboard so you can relate to one and despise others (New Loka are dirty hippies, Red Veil are edgelords anonymous)

Bosses tend to be massively underwhelming weakpoint simulations that through mobs at you but the few exceptions allow for some great teamwork, though power creep is an issue, as you can comparatively become as powerful as you are in the last chapter of an RPG or action game pretty soon.

This is at the core a grinding simulator that you can ease the pain with friends, though it’s not the progression that's addicting but more the movement, combat and gameplay. It can be completely altered by one's choice in frame, and though it can sometimes feel light the combat is some of the fastest I’ve seen outside of a PlatinumGames tittle.
